Three $50,000 Mississippi Lottery Winners in a Row

Streak of Powerball wins marks a milestone for the state

A Mississippi Lottery player has added to an unprecedented streak of Powerball wins, becoming the third $50,000 winner in as many drawings with a ticket purchased at Keith's Super Store #80 in Lucedale. This latest win follows two other $50,000 prizes claimed in back-to-back drawings, marking a milestone of three consecutive $50,000 wins across three drawings.

The details

The other two $50,000 Powerball winners came from Circle K #270515 in Southaven and Sprint Mart #9 in Fulton. The Mississippi Lottery has seen an impressive run of large prize winners in recent months, indicating growing engagement with the state's relatively new lottery system.
